  • Q: How to replace the valve rocker arm and push rods on 2003 Chevrolet Corvette?
    A: The first step involves removing the valve Rocker Arm covers to enable the positioning of valve rocker arms with valve pushrods and pivot support into a rack. Start the replacement by uninstalling the valve Rocker Arm bolts, the valve rocker arms, the valve Rocker Arm pivot support and the pushrods. The technician must clean and inspect each valve Rocker Arm followed by pushing rod examination. The valve rocker arms along with pushrods should receive clean engine oil for lubrication during installation. The valve Rocker Arm bolt flange also needs lubrication. The valve Rocker Arm pivot support should go in after the pushrods achieve proper seating in the valve lifter sockets and the pushrods should settle into the rocker arms. Place the rocker arms and their bolts on the engine without performing any tightening. The Crankshaft requires rotation until the number one Piston reaches top dead center (TDC) compression stroke position where cylinder number one rocker arms should be off lobe lift and the Crankshaft sprocket key needs to rest at the 1:30 position. While the number one firing position exists, apply torque of 30 nm (22 ft. Lbs.) to exhaust valve Rocker Arm bolts numbers 1, 2, 7, and 8 and the intake valve Rocker Arm bolts numbered 1, 3, 4, and 5. Double the Crankshaft rotation to 360 degrees prior to torquing exhaust valve Rocker Arm bolts 3, 4, 5, 6 to 30 nm (22 ft. Lbs.) then do the same with intake valve Rocker Arm bolts 2, 6, 7, 8 to 30 nm (22 ft. Lbs.). Place and tighten the valve Rocker Arm covers to finish the operation.
